Output 333d1e20d8150dfae0caa05c0c0275452ee5ec43f62fda18cc4f34e11ab169c2:22

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440a15e5deebc40891dadf8a08e00236839ba382 OP_EQUAL
address
DBLra4LoqSaPzKk1jbpxK1bBFcAZrtvZ5t
transaction
333d1e20d8150dfae0caa05c0c0275452ee5ec43f62fda18cc4f34e11ab169c2
spent
true